Police say a man in his 50’s is in life-threatening condition after being struck by vehicle while cycling in Scarborough Monday evening.
Cyclist in life-threatening condition after being struck by vehicle in Scarborough

Police say a man in his 50’s is in life-threatening condition after being struck by vehicle while cycling in Scarborough Monday evening.